A HUSBAND paid a fitting tribute to his beloved wife...by sending her ashes into the skies above the sea at Mersea Harbour as part of a fireworks display.

Mick Tyler arranged for wife Margaret’s ashes to be embedded into a special firework which was fired as part of the showstopping display which brings an end to Mersea Regatta.

The couple were regular visitors to waterside sporting event and the island was one of their most-loved spots.

Mr Tyler, 74, said: “We used to go down to the regatta most years if we could, mainly for the fireworks.

“It was something we had talked about over the years and we thought it was quite a good idea - to go out with a bang. I found it sort of gave me a sense of closure on things, a last finale.”

Mrs Tyler died at the age of 71 after a decade long battle with Alzheimer’s.

The couple had known each other since they were teenagers and were married for 51 years.

Mrs Tyler spent the last five-and-a-half years in a care home but Mr Tyler has fond memories of visiting Mersea from their Colchester home and walking its coastline.

Mr Tyler said: “Once a week we used to go to Mersea and go walking. We loved it there.

“I wanted to do something different after Margaret passed away and so I approached Dynamic Fireworks and they told me it could be done.

“I was going to do it privately but obviously you’re restricted as to where you can do it.

“I suggested East Mersea and then I heard Dynamic were doing the regatta fireworks.

“I asked them and they said it was fine as long as the regatta committee said it was OK.”

The committee agreed and so an emotional Mr Tyler and daughter Gemma watched the tribute from the crowds on Saturday.

He said: “I did not realise but in the middle of the display there were some fireworks shaped like hearts - that moment really got me. It was obviously emotional for me.

“I hope she would have liked it but it was for me as well as her.”
